Hello Window! - GTK+/gtkmm programozás GNU/Linux alatt

A 2008 októberi lapszámban található, "Hello Window! - GTK+/gtkmm programozás GNU/Linux alatt" cikk fóruma.

Kivonat:
GTK+ (GIMP Toolkit) egy C nyelven -ám objektum-orientált megközelítéssel- íródott, grafikus felhasználói felületek (GUI) létrehozására használatos alkalmazás-programozási interfész. A gtkmm nem más, mint ennek a függvénykönyvtának a C++ változata, pontosabban foglamazva wrappere. Mindkét terjesztése LGPL licensz alatt történik, így bátran felhasználható mind szabad/ingyenes, mind kereskedelmi szoftevrek létrehozására.
A most kezdődő sorozat célja az abszólút kezdetektől indulva bemutatni a GTK+ és a gtkmm hasonlóságait, különbözőségeit, sajátosságait eljutva egy olyan szintre, ahol remélhetőleg a több éves tapasztalattal rendelkező fejlesztők is találnak hasznos, megfontolásra érdemes ötleteket, információkat.

Ide észrevételeket, kiegészítéseket, ötleteket várunk és mindent ami szorosan a cikkhez kapcsolódik.

Hiba: Hello Window! - GTK+/gtkmm

A magazinban és a letölthető forráskódban össze van cserélve a fejléc. Melyik a jó??? Még valami, teljesen kezdő vagyok ebben a témábam milyen csomagot kell telepíteni ahoz, hogy forduljon a progi? Előre is köszönöm a segítséget!
Hbaüzenet:
-cflags: unknown option
gtk_window.c:1:21: error: gtk/gtk.h: Nincs ilyen fájl vagy könyvtár
gtk_window.c: In function ‘main’:
gtk_window.c:4: error: ‘GtkWidget’ undeclared (first use in this function)
gtk_window.c:4: error: (Each undeclared identifier is reported only once
gtk_window.c:4: error: for each function it appears in.)
gtk_window.c:4: error: ‘window’ undeclared (first use in this function)
gtk_window.c:6: error: ‘GTK_WINDOW_TOPLEWEL’ undeclared (first use in this function)

1 javítva

A fanzinban található forráskód a helyes, ahogy azóta már a letölthetőeket is aktualizáltuk. Köszönjük az észrevételt!
A hibaüzenetre:
a "cflags" és a "libs" esetében feltehetően az egy helyett, a két kötőjel (--cflags és --libs) használata a helyénvaló, továbbá szerintem szükség lehet a "llibgtkmm-2.4-dev" és a "libgtk2.0-dev" csomagokra, de majd a hozzá jobban értők helyesbítsenek!

Köszi, működik.

Köszi, működik. A fanzinban a cflags és a libs egy kötőjellel volt írva.

Javítva

Valóban, a szövegfeldolgozás során lemaradt a kettős kötőjel. Javítottuk és ismételt köszönet az észrevételért!